Understanding the Role of Dress Packs in Industrial Robotics
Dress packs play a vital role in the functionality and efficiency of industrial robots. By effectively bundling and protecting cables, air hoses, and water pipes, they ensure that these components remain intact during operation. The innovative design of modern dress packs allows for high mobility without obstructing robotic movement. Moreover, their materials are tailored to withstand the rigors of industrial use, providing durability and resistance against wear.

Best Practices for Maintaining Industrial Robot Dress Packs
Proper maintenance of industrial robot dress packs is crucial for ensuring longevity and optimal performance. Regular inspections should be conducted to check for wear and tear, as well as to ensure that all components, such as hoses and clips, are securely in place. Lubricating the dress pack joints can minimize friction and reduce the risk of damage during operations. It's also essential to keep the dress packs clean, as accumulated dirt and debris can impede functionality. Applications of Dress Packs Across Various Industries
Dress packs play a vital role in a multitude of industries by safeguarding essential cables and hoses from wear and environmental factors. In the automotive manufacturing sector, for instance, these systems facilitate smooth operation amidst high-speed assembly lines. In rail transportation, dress packs protect vital electrical lines against vibrations and movement, ensuring consistent performance over time. The shipbuilding industry relies on robust dress pack systems for cable management in harsh maritime conditions. Moreover, industrial automation benefits from the flexibility offered by modern dress packs, which allow robots to move freely while maintaining effective cable protection.
